Kirchhoff, Walter - Signed Cabinet Photograph in Meistersinger 1917 Autographs Actresses - Letter C OTHERS AVAILABLE AND NOT LISTEDGerman tenor (1879 1951), who possessed a powerful metallic tenor voice with which he had great success, especially in the difficult Wagner repertoire. Beautiful cabinet photograph signed by him, shown as Walther von Stolzing in Wagner's Die Meistersinger, dated in Berlin in 1917; a photo by A. Pifperhoff, Bayreuth.
